How to Convert Micrometer to Centimeter

1 micrometer = 0.0001 centimeters

Centimeter = Micrometer × 0.0001

Example: 282 μm × 0.0001 = 0.0282 cm

Reverse Conversion

To convert centimeters back to micrometers:

  • Remember, 1 centimeter equals 10000 micrometers.
  • To convert 0.0282 cm to μm, multiply 0.0282 x 10000, resulting in 282 μm.
